Lucinda's: A Honky-Tonk Haven in the East Village

Lucinda’s is a new honky-tonk style bar in the East Village, co-owned by the renowned singer/songwriter Lucinda Williams. The bar recently had its unofficial opening with Williams and her band gracing the stage in an invite-only event. The venue, previously known as Heaven Can Wait, has undergone a transformation under the ownership of Williams, Laura McCarthy, and Kelley Swindall, who is also the general manager. The atmosphere at Lucinda’s exudes a sense of history and charm, with carefully curated decor and a nod to blues and folk music icons.
Kelley Swindall, who pitched the idea of opening a club to Williams, played a significant role in finding memorabilia and artwork for the venue. Williams, known for her interest in outsider folk art and blues music, contributed to curating the decor and selecting the liquor and wine offerings. The bar features vintage imagery, black-and-white prints of country icons, and artwork by renowned artists like Danny Clinch and Jon Langford. The venue pays homage to music legends like Muddy Waters and Sister Rosetta Tharpe, creating a unique and inviting space for music enthusiasts.
The recent live show at Lucinda’s, broadcast on Sirius XM, featured a performance by Laura Cantrell and her band, with special guest Mary Lee Kortes. Cantrell, who has a history with the venue from its Brownie’s days, praised the new iteration as a spiritual successor to the old space. Despite facing health challenges, Williams remains dedicated to her music and the success of Lucinda’s. While recovering from a stroke in 2020, Williams continues to tour and perform with her band, delivering a mix of classic hits and newer songs. The bar's ethos of music and fun was evident during the performance, with Williams emphasizing the importance of enjoying music and creating a lively atmosphere at Lucinda’s. The set included a tribute to Tom Petty and a heartfelt cover of “While My Guitar Gently Weeps,” showcasing Williams' enduring passion for music and her commitment to providing a memorable experience at her bar.
